h2 { color: #4E8ABE; }
#content p { margin: 14px 50px 0 0 ; }
#spaDetails_rtCol span { display: block; margin-right: 60px; line-height: 12px; font-size: 10px; border-top: 1px solid #d6d6d6; padding-top: 6px;  }
#spaDetails_rtCol p span { position: relative; left: 63px; border-top: none; padding-top: 0; }
#content #spaDetails_rtCol p span a { text-decoration: underline; color: #000; }

#hider, #disclaimer { display: none; }
#disclaimer { padding: 20px; width: 400px; background-color: #fff; font: 10px/12px Tahoma; position: absolute; top: 20%; left: 20%; z-index:20000; }
#content .sub2 a#showdisc { font-weight: normal; text-decoration: underline; }
